Buhari, Jonathan, Sambo Attend Anyim Pius Anyim’s Birthday Party

President Muhammadu Buhari and his predecessor, Goodluck Jonathan, on Saturday graced the birthday celebrations of former Senate President, Anyim Pius Anyim.
www.tracknews.ng reports that Anyim’s 61st birthday celebration was held at the International Conference Centre, Abuja.
Buhari, who was represented by the Secretary to the Government of the Federation (SGF), Boss Mustapha, was accompanied by aides and other government officials.
Also at the event are former Vice President, Namadi Sambo, former Senate President, Adolphus Wabara and ex-Sokoto state state governor, Attahiru Bafarawa, among others.
Speaking at the event, Jonathan described Anyim as a humble man who did well to serve Nigeria creditably when he was Senate President and SGF.
The former president also stated that Anyim can do better “if given the opportunity” having done well in previous positions.
This newspaper reports that Anyim has declared his intention to contest for the presidency in 2023 on the platform of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P).
